    Primary Function

    Gain growth and knowledge of the mortgage industry through on-line training, courses and working with the Sales Coaches. Interact with both sales and Newrez clients to help with the understanding of the mortgage industry and expanding into the Mortgage Consultant role.

    Principal Duties:
    • Performs related duties as assigned by supervisor.
    • Engage with consumers, determine their needs, and offer the appropriate product.
    • Take mortgage loan applications by phone and prepare effective loan proposals.
    • Provide superior customer service.
    • Meet monthly production goals.
    • Stay informed of developing trends in the mortgage industry.
    • Attend/assist with scheduled meetings, training sessions and courses.
    • Maintain compliance with the NewRez Code of Conduct.
